Training and education to become a nature photographer

In order to work as a nature photographer, it is necessary to know the different techniques in order to master the basics thanks to training courses. In France, there are several diplomas to become a photographer: Bac pro in photography, BEP in photography, BTM in photography and BTS in photography. The training course can extend to a master's degree (bac+5). A nature photographer is extremely patient and often solitary. They are able to work through the night and even in difficult conditions such as heavy rain or storms. They are detail-oriented and have a good command of various image capture techniques, including macro photography.

The scope of a nature photographer's work

The nature photographer's job is very broad compared to other fields. Whether it is to capture beautiful images of snowy landscapes, sunsets or insects, he can do it. In general, his aim is to enhance the essence of wildlife in images. He is also dedicated to landscape and environmental photography. He advocates naturalness and originality in his nature shots to better meet the needs of his clients. In other words, the nature photographer does not retouch photos unless there are imperfections. He can also create beautiful shots of predators on the hunt, felines and birds. In addition, he can produce animal portraits, travel photo books and reports on endemic plants. The nature photographer is attentive to every request and can work for private individuals and professionals.

Rates for a nature photographer

The costs of a nature photographer's service vary between 60€ and 150€. A nature photographer often uses a high-end camera with a long focal length lens. They can also travel to different locations depending on the needs of their clients, so prices can vary depending on location, equipment and the length of the shoot.

How to choose the right nature photographer?

Before choosing a nature photographer, it is important to look at their portfolio to see what they do and what they specialise in. Next, you need to know if his or her rates fit the budget. It is best to hire a professional photographer with affordable rates. Finally, it is necessary to know the background of the photographer to ensure the quality of the images.

Questions to ask a photographer on first contact

Why do they like to photograph nature? Is the photographer experienced? What places has he/she already visited for nature photography? How much does the nature photographer charge? Can he/she give an estimate of the price of his/her photographs? How long does it take to complete the nature photographs?
